TRAINING THE STUDENTS FOR FOREIGN LANGUAGE COMMUNICATION IN THE SPHERE OF TOURISM AS A PROBLEM

Valentina Nikolaevna Kartashova
Yelets State University named after I. A. Bunin

Evangelina Romanovna Demina
Yelets State University named after I. A. Bunin


Submitted: May 1, 2016
Abstract. The article examines methodical foundations to train students for foreign language communication in the sphere of tourism. According to the authors, the content of foreign language school education should be aimed to study tourist discourse and should be based on the multi-genre texts. The paper clarifies that the verbal genres of advertising and tourist discourse, in particular, video advertising, have a great educational potential.
